Definitions from Wiktionary (
)
American English Definition British English Definition
verb:  To write or speak at length; to be copious in argument or discussion.
verb:  (rare) To range at large, or without restraint.
verb:  (obsolete) To expand; to spread; to extend; to diffuse; to broaden.
